Ping is still 130 while the router shows the modulation DSL Type:ITU-T G.992.1. You can try this "Login to the Thomson via telnet.
Type menu and use arrow and tab key to navigate.. go to xdsl, debug, multimode, and in config use the up arrow to get to g992.1_annex_a.
Press enter.. tab to ok.. press enter."as taken from here.
